Output 96e697c879e4d958e537f04c7fa065b2e0bdfd3493fa43854799afa62d6b3bf2:59

value
1420688951
script pubkey
OP_0 OP_PUSHBYTES_20 118a7d2bdef489da7a2074dfc7848f7b9071fd33
address
bc1qzx9862777jya573qwn0u0py00wg8rlfnjms76h
transaction
96e697c879e4d958e537f04c7fa065b2e0bdfd3493fa43854799afa62d6b3bf2
confirmations
84129
spent
true